Gummie {Gumball} Necklace!!!

March 8, 2011 By Stacy 30 Comments

I am sure you know by now that gumballs are a pretty big trend in parties this year. I just ordered some pink, green, and blue beauties for baby P’s 1st birthday party myself. On top of that One Charming Party posted these BEAUTIFUL gumball necklaces a couple month ago! Does it get any cuter than that? So yesterday I was walking through Super Target and while in the bulk candy section I came across Alphabet Gummies and after a little spray of WD-40, the wheels in my head started turning and I snatched them up (plus they were on sale) along with a small bag of colorful gumballs. Here is what I came up with…a Gummie & Gumball Name Necklace!! Stringing the gumballs and gummies was harder than I had thought but the whole project took about 15-20 minutes, so it’s totally doable as party favors! In the pictures below I show some 6mm double faced satin ribbon but I ended up using baker’s twine from The Twinery instead (however if you wanted the ends to be fancy like the ones on One Charming Party you could string the gumballs and gummies with the twine and then tie the twine to prettier ribbon for the necklace part). I thought it turned out super cute and my daughter just loved it! I think this would also be really cute as a gumball bracelet with a single letter gummie “charm”!!
